About Barhans

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Barhans village is 309492. Barhans village is located in Karandighi subdivision of Uttar Dinajpur district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 18.1km away from sub-district headquarter Karandighi. Raiganj is the district headquarter of Barhans village. As per 2009 stats, Domohona is the gram panchayat of Barhans village.

The total geographical area of village is 134.76 hectares. Barhans has a total population of 2,542 peoples, out of which male population is 1,277 while female population is 1,265.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 990 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of barhans village is 44.85% out of which 48.55% males and 41.11% females are literate. There are about 447 houses in barhans village. Pincode of barhans village locality is 733201.

When it comes to administration, Barhans village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Barhans village comes under Karandighi Vidhan Sabha constituency & Raiganj Lok Sabha constituency. Raigunj is nearest town to barhans village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Barhans

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,542 1,277 1,265
Children (0-6) 505 272 233
Scheduled Castes (SC) 35 18 17
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 1,140 620 520
Illiterate Population 1,402 657 745
